Trick Benefits of RLE Eye Surgical treatment vs. LASIK: Which Is Right for You?



When considering eye surgical procedure, how do you make a decision in between RLE (Refractive Lens Exchange) and LASIK?

RLE commonly matches individuals over 40, particularly those with presbyopia, as it addresses both vision correction and cataracts in one treatment. Unlike LASIK, which improves the cornea, RLE changes the eye's all-natural lens, offering a long-term service for different vision problems.

If you have a high prescription or slim corneas, RLE could be a much safer selection since it stays clear of corneal alteration. In addition, RLE can minimize your reliance on glasses or get in touches with dramatically.

On the other hand, LASIK is quicker with a quicker healing time.

Eventually, your way of living, age, and certain vision needs will guide your decision.

Vital Healing Tips and Timeline After RLE Eye Surgical Treatment



After undertaking RLE eye surgical procedure, it's critical to comply with a recuperation strategy to ensure the most effective possible result.

Initially, rest your eyes for a minimum of a few days. Stay clear of straining them with screens or reading. Remember to put on sunglasses outdoors to safeguard your eyes from bright light and dust.

Take recommended medications as guided, and attend all follow-up appointments. You might see variations in your vision originally; this is typical.

Gradually resume everyday activities, however avoid heavy training or laborious workout for a couple of weeks.

Remain moisturized and keep a well balanced diet regimen to sustain healing.
